The Portland Oregon Affidavit of Service regarding Petition and Summons is a legal document that is filed with the court to provide proof that an individual has been properly served with a petition and summons in a legal proceeding. This affidavit is crucial to ensure that the legal process is fair and just for all parties involved. When filing an Affidavit of Service, it is important to include specific information to establish the validity of the service. The affidavit should contain details such as the date and time of service, the location where the service took place, the name of the person who was served, and their relationship to the case. It is also essential to include the method of service, whether it was done personally, through certified mail, or by another authorized means. In Portland, Oregon, there are three common types of Affidavits of Service regarding Petition and Summons that are recognized by the court system: personal service, service by certified mail, and service by publication. 1. Personal Service: This method involves physically delivering the petition and summons to the respondent. The person serving the documents must be at least 18 years old and not a party to the case. The affidavit should include details of how the service was performed and the name and description of the person who received the documents. 2. Service by Certified Mail: This method involves sending the petition and summons to the respondent via certified mail. The affidavit should include the tracking number of the certified mail, the date it was sent, and the name of the person who signed for the documents upon delivery. 3. Service by Publication: This method is used when the whereabouts of the respondent are unknown, or they cannot be personally served. In such cases, a notice is published in a newspaper or other authorized publication for a certain period, usually determined by the court. The affidavit should include information such as the name of the publication, the dates of publication, and a copy of the published notice. Submitting a valid and accurate Affidavit of Service regarding Petition and Summons is critical as it serves as evidence that the respondent has been properly notified of the legal proceedings and ensures the individual's right to due process. Failure to comply with the requirements can result in delays or complications in the case.
